Membrane Computing 19th International Conference, CMC 2018, Dresden, Germany, September 4–7, 2018, Revised Selected Papers

This book constitutes revised selected papers from the 19th International Conference on Membrane Computing (CMC19), CMC 2018, which was held in Dresden, Germany, in September 2018. The 15 papers presented in this volume were carefully reviewed and selected from 20 submissions. The contributions aim...
